Another salmonella outbreak recall from a grocery chain in Florida and 23 other states

The latest recall rippling from a salmonella outbreak linked to cucumbers came from the Sprouts Farmers Market supermarket chain, which yanked its Gyro Family Kits.

Supplier Reser’s Fine Foods told Sprouts the cucumbers in the kit’s tzatziki sauce might have salmonella. A different company recalled the same product, gyro sandwich kits, for the same reason from Walmart’s Sam’s Club stores last week.

Sprouts Gyro Family Kits in this recall have UPC No. 20594800000 and use by dates from 12/29/24 to 1/7/25.

Reser’s Fine Foods recalled Gyro Family Kits made for Sprouts.

They went to stores in Florida, North Carolina, South Carolina, California, Missouri, Texas, Pennsylvania, Alabama, Arizona, Colorado, Delaware, Georgia, Kansas, Louisiana, Maryland, New Jersey, New Mexico, Nevada, Oklahoma, Tennessee, Utah, Virginia, Washington and Wyoming.

Return the kits to the Sprouts store of purchase for a refund. Direct questions to Sprouts at sprouts.com/contact.

About salmonella

According to the CDC, salmonella strikes 1.35 million in the United States each year, hospitalizes around 26,000 and kills about 420. The vast majority of people suffer through vomiting, diarrhea and stomachaches for four to seven days, then recover without needing medical attention. Children under 5 and adults over 65 suffer the worst symptoms.
